Fiesta Insurance Franchise Corporation reported a data security breach to the California Attorney General. The breach occurred on May 25, 2026. The notice letter is heavily redacted, obscuring the specific nature of the incident, the types of data compromised, and the number of affected individuals. However, the offer of credit monitoring and fraud alert instructions suggests potential exposure of financial or identity information. The company has established a toll-free response line and is offering complimentary identity theft protection services.
